When selecting bamboo wood wall panels for your home decor, the color and texture play a crucial role in achieving the desired aesthetic. According to a report by the Wood Products Council, the warmth of bamboo's natural tones, which range from light beige to deep caramel, can significantly enhance a room's ambiance. Light-colored panels can create a sense of spaciousness, making them ideal for smaller rooms, while darker shades add depth and richness, contributing to a more intimate atmosphere.
Texture, on the other hand, is equally important to complement the chosen color. Smooth finishes impart a modern and sleek look, fitting well in contemporary spaces. Conversely, textured panels, like those with a hand-scraped finish, bring an element of rustic charm, appealing to the growing trend of biophilic design. When considering bamboo wall panels for your home decor, installation and maintenance are key factors that can greatly affect the long-term enjoyment of your choice. Firstly, it's essential to prepare your walls properly to ensure a smooth installation process. Make sure to clean the surface and repair any imperfections before applying adhesive or nails. Bamboo panels can be installed either horizontally or vertically, depending on your design preference, but it’s important to keep in mind the room’s dimensions and the flow of natural light to enhance the aesthetic appeal.
Maintenance of bamboo wall panels is relatively straightforward but requires attention to detail to maintain their beauty and durability. Regular dusting with a soft cloth will help prevent the buildup of dirt and allergens. Additionally, using a damp cloth with mild soap can clean stains without damaging the wood’s finish. It's crucial to avoid har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ners, as they can compromise the natural fibers of the bamboo. Finally, consider applying a protective sealant every few years to enhance water resistance and preserve the vibrant color of the panels, ensuring they remain a stunning element of your home for years to come.
